The systematic approach to problem-solving is called the scientific method. The scientific method is a step-by-step process used by scientists to investigate and understand natural phenomena. It involves making observations, formulating a hypothesis, conducting experiments or gathering data, analyzing the results, and drawing conclusions. The scientific method provides a structured way to approach problems, ensuring that investigations are logical, repeatable, and empirically grounded.
